Eldoret, nestled amidst/within/at the heart of Kenya's breathtaking landscapes, stands as a testament to unwavering human spirit and unyielding progress. This vibrant city, a bustling hub of commerce/economic https://aoifeljuf836667.onzeblog.com/40289561/eldoret-a-symphony-of-progress